No BS summary

Entry-level remote role in healthcare revenue cycle management. Follows up with payers to resolve claim denials, payment variances, and appeals. Requires basic computer skills, Excel proficiency, and strong verbal/communication skills. Pays $17.00–$18.65/hr.

What you'll do

  • Examines denied and other non-paid claims to determine the reason for discrepancies.
  • Communicates directly with payers to follow up on outstanding claims, files technical and clinical appeals, resolves payment variances, and ensures timely and accurate reimbursement.
  • Ability to identify specific reasons for underpayments, denials, and cause of payment delay.
  • Works with management to identify, trend, and address root causes of issues in the A/R.
  • Maintains a thorough understanding of federal and state regulations, as well as payer specific requirements and takes appropriate action accordingly.
  • Documents all activity accurately including contact names, addresses, phone numbers, and other pertinent information in the client's host system and/or appropriate tracking system.
  • Demonstrates initiative and resourcefulness by making recommendations and communicating trends and issues to management.
  • Needs to be a strong problem solver and critical thinker to resolve accounts.
